Output ab30c139ab9440df9cdf623923e26a73c8ae9223f381bda3226b9215b77d47aa:0

value
3559814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c22fffeaa452a6bea62dd538ae1464ef9f984d OP_EQUAL
address
3NpSeEuPtBpV2pUNjEY4dVMeCJNYJ2dudz
transaction
ab30c139ab9440df9cdf623923e26a73c8ae9223f381bda3226b9215b77d47aa
spent
true